Colourful Georgian buildings line the streets of this charming town where the award-winning Clonakilty Black Pudding originated. Explore the Michael Collins House museum, then catch traditional Irish music sessions at local pubs like De Barra's Folk Club.

Best time to go to Clonakilty

The best time to visit Clonakilty is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January42.8°F (6.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February43.3°F (6.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March44.2°F (6.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April47.1°F (8.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May51.4°F (10.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June56.5°F (13.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
July59.4°F (15.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August58.6°F (14.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
September56.1°F (13.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October52.2°F (11.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November46.8°F (8.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
December44.2°F (6.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

What are the top places to visit in Clonakilty?
Cultural venues include Michael Collins House, Michael Collins Centre and Birthplace of Michael Collins. Landmarks like Galley Head Lightkeeper's House, Temblebryan Stone Circle and Ringfort Lios-na-gCon might be worth a visit. A couple of additional sights to add to your itinerary are West Cork Model Railway Village and West Cork Surf School. Take a look at what more there is to see and do in Expedia's Clonakilty guide.
What's the seasonal weather like in Clonakilty?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Clonakilty is 1037 mm.
